Key Obligations of a Court Typist



While you could think the role of a court typist is entirely regarding keying, it incorporates a range of essential obligations that ensure the lawful procedure runs efficiently. You'll be accountable for transcribing depositions, trials, and hearings properly, ensuring every detail is caught. You'll additionally evaluate and check records for mistakes, keeping a high degree of precision and clarity.In enhancement to transcription, you'll arrange and submit lawful documents, making them easily accessible for lawyers and courts. You may require to help in preparing case documents and updating documents as called for. Effective interaction is vital, as you'll commonly work together with legal workers to make clear details or gather needed details.Your duty likewise consists of taking care of deadlines, so timely completion of documents is important. By satisfying these responsibilities, you play a crucial part in making sure and supporting the judicial system that legal procedures are recorded appropriately.

Tools for Accurate Transcription



To nail precise transcription in the court, you need the right tools at your fingertips. A high-grade transcription software program can considerably improve your effectiveness, allowing you to catch every word precisely. Buy a trusted headset to strain history noise and guarantee clearness in audio recordings. A foot pedal can likewise quicken your operations, letting you control playback hands-free. Furthermore, preserving a substantial legal thesaurus or reference assists you rapidly reference terms, making certain you do not miss crucial information. It's essential to have a comfy, ergonomic workstation to minimize interruptions and tiredness during long sessions. By furnishing yourself with these essential tools, you'll improve your accuracy and contribute successfully to the lawful procedure.

What Tools or Software Do Court Typists Commonly Make Use Of?



Court typists normally utilize transcription software, word processing program like Microsoft Word, and specialized court reporting devices. You'll additionally depend on foot pedals and top quality headsets to enhance precision and efficiency in your transcription jobs.

What Is the Typical Salary for a Court Typist?



The ordinary income for a court typist differs by location and experience, yet you can expect it to vary from $35,000 to $55,000 every year. Research study local task listings to obtain a much better feeling of salaries.
